How Do Winter Storms Affect Air Travel?
Winter storms can cause significant delays and cancellations due to poor visibility, heavy snowfall, and icy conditions. Airlines often preemptively cancel flights in anticipation of severe weather to ensure passenger safety. Additionally, airports may close temporarily or limit operations when conditions become hazardous.
